About Shermco

Since 1974, Shermco has become North America’s largest and fastest growing NETA-accredited electrical testing organization. Our focus is to make sure electrical power systems are functioning properly and safely. Additionally, our Professional Engineering Group, Rotating Machinery Division, Renewable Energy Services, and Field Repair and local Repair Service Centers, places Shermco in a position to handle all things electrical, all done with an emphasis on safety and client service. Shermco is ISO certified, a member of EASA, AWEA, PEARL and is accredited by NETA, PEV, SKF & ANAB. Shermco Industries is a founding member of NETA and has one of the largest field services divisions in the industry.

Responsibilities






  • The primary role of this position will be to provide business development, from identifying and targeting key customers through validation of opportunities within energy and industrial sectors, leading to proposals and successful closing of work.
  • Identify, develop, and implement market and business development strategies and supporting tactical plans. 
  • Qualify prospective sales opportunities to determine which opportunities to pursue. 
  • Accountable for attaining yearly multi-million-dollar sales budgets.
  • Maintain industry knowledge and improve technical knowledge based on market requirements. 
  • Support our key marketing activities such as road shows, national conferences, tradeshows, sales trainings, and trade organizations. 
  • Perform job walks and assist in the preparation of estimates, sales proposals, and sales presentations. 
  • Visit account(s) on a regular basis to maintain a "strategic relationship" status.
  • Support sales processes, entering and managing sales activity within CRM, securing purchase orders, terms and conditions, and maintaining customer relations.
  • Be a front-line focal point between sales and project management/construction throughout the project cycle.








Qualifications






  • Bachelor's degree is desired but not required.
  • 5+ years of successful outside B2B sales experience, preferably in an engineering, heavy industrial market. Preference given to candidates with a successful sales track selling electrical equipment or motor repair and services or experience selling VFD (Variable Frequency Drives) or industrial motor controls.
  • Demonstrated ability to be self-directed and highly motivated. 
  • Strong interpersonal, communication, written and oral presentation skills and solid understanding of profitability and other financial measurements. 
  • Strong sales skills including effective negotiating skills, ability to successfully interact with key customer decision makers and influencers, and ability to prospect new customers and forecast future business. 
  • Must be able to demonstrate technical knowledge and consultative skills. 
  • Required overnight travel 
  • Advanced computer skills with the following software: Excel, Word, Adobe, Microsoft Outlook.
  • Proficiency with CRM and lead software like Salesforce and Industrial Info Resources.
